Top 5 Tennis Games on Android in Latin America: Q4 2024
Explore the performance of the top tennis games on Android in Latin America during Q4 2024,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2024, the top tennis games on Android in Latin America showcased var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. According to data from Sensor Tower, these games have seen interesting trends throughout the quarter.
Tennis Clash: Multiplayer Game by Wildlife Studios maintained a strong presence with weekly downloads peaking at approximately 63.7K in early October. However, a gradual decline followed, ending the year around 42.7K. Revenue also experienced fluctuations, starting at $11K and dipping mid-quarter before rallying to close December with $9.7K. The game’s active users started at 340K, declining to around 267K by year’s end.
Mini Tennis: Perfect Smash from Miniclip.com saw a steady stream of downloads, with a noticeable spike to 6.7K in the final week of December. Revenue remained modest, reaching a high of $349 in the last week of the quarter. The game’s active user base showed a significant increase, ending the quarter with 223K users.
Tennis Arena by Helium9 Games observed a consistent download pattern, culminating in a peak of 8.2K at the end of December. Revenue varied, peaking at $375 in early December, while active users grew substantially from 15.6K to 29.1K over the quarter.
TOP SEED Tennis Manager 2025 by Gaminho exhibited minimal activity, with downloads barely reaching double digits and revenue peaking at $104 in early October. Its active user count decreased slightly, finishing the quarter at 100.
Finally, Virtua Tennis Challenge by SEGA experienced steady downloads around 1K weekly, with revenue peaking in mid-December at $39. Active users remained stable, closing the year just under 2.5K.
